The mechanism of action for Aprepitant is quite targeted. It works by blocking the action of substance P, a natural substance found in the brain that is a key trigger for vomiting. By preventing substance P from binding to NK-1 receptors, Aprepitant effectively interrupts the emetic signals that lead to nausea and vomiting. This targeted approach makes it a vital component in CINV management.

Clinical studies have consistently shown the benefits of Aprepitant. It is often used in combination with other antiemetic drugs, such as 5-HT3 receptor inhibitors (like ondansetron) and corticosteroids (like dexamethasone). This combination therapy approach has been proven to significantly reduce both the acute and delayed phases of nausea and vomiting induced by chemotherapy. The result is improved patient tolerance of chemotherapy, allowing them to complete their treatment cycles with less disruption and discomfort.
